Address

ecash:qpjz287zy7f4quwdqxazyw80mx73cxee8g2usc54mtCopy

Total Received

13860.13 XEC

Total Sent

13860.13 XEC

№ Transactions

2

Final Balance

0 XEC

Transactions
Filter